50-32-605 . Prescribing and dispensing authority for opioid antagonist. A medical practitioner may prescribe, directly, by a standing order, or by a collaborative practice agreement, or dispense, as permitted under 37-2-104 , an opioid antagonist to an eligible recipient. The medical practitioner shall document the reasons for which the opioid antagonist was prescribed or dispensed.

Legislative History

En. Sec. 5, Ch. 253, L. 2017.
